- choose the best answer. the force of friction ____ when there is less surface area between objects. decreases increases
The force of friction is not dependent on the surface - area in contact between objects under normal circumstances. However, a common - sense understanding might lead one to think that less surface area means less contact and thus less friction. In reality, for dry friction, the force of friction is given by $F_f=\mu N$, where $\mu$ is the coefficient of friction and $N$ is the normal force, and is independent of surface area. But if we consider the context of a non - ideal situation where less surface area could mean less inter - molecular or inter - atomic interactions in some cases, we would say the force of friction decreases.
